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Physician Assistants in Gwinnett, Georgia play a crucial role in providing healthcare services to the community. - Entry-level Physician Assistant salaries range from $80,000 to $90,000 per year - Mid-career Clinical Supervisor salaries range from $90,000 to $110,000 per year - Senior-level Physician Assistant Manager salaries range from $110,000 to $130,000 per year The history of Physician Assistants in Gwinnett dates back to the 1970s when the profession was first established to address the shortage of primary care physicians. Since then, PAs have become an integral part of the healthcare system, collaborating with physicians to provide high-quality patient care. Over the years, the role of Physician Assistants in Gwinnett has evolved to encompass a wide range of specialties, from primary care to surgical settings. PAs now have the opportunity to specialize in areas such as dermatology, cardiology, and emergency medicine, providing specialized care to patients in need. Current trends in the field of Physician Assistants in Gwinnett include an increasing emphasis on telemedicine and remote patient care, as well as a growing focus on preventative medicine and chronic disease management. PAs are also taking on more leadership roles within healthcare organizations, advocating for their profession and advancing the quality of care for patients.
